Many of my clients who find themselves in the heat of crisis also discover that they’re gaining weight, particularly in the belly area. This, of course is due to a number of factors including high cortisol in the body from being overstressed, as well as bad eating habits and lack of exercise. In moments such as these, when the body is under extreme duress from crisis, it’s important to eat the right things. Hence, this short video on Eggs and Oatmeal for weight loss.
